在当今数字化经济和信息技术日益发展的背景下,区块链技术凭借其去中心化、不可篡改和透明性的特点,逐渐成为数据管理和交易的主流选择。然而,随着网络攻击和数据泄漏事件的频繁发生,单纯依靠区块链技术本身已难以满足日益严峻的数据安全和隐私保护需求。在此背景下,可信计算区块链作为一种新兴概念和技术,逐渐走入公众视野。
可信计算区块链融合了可信计算与区块链的优势,通过可信计算技术确保区块链上数据的完整性与可用性,从而提升系统的安全性和隐私保护能力。本文将深入探讨可信计算区块链的定义、机制、应用领域及未来发展趋势。
可信计算(Trusted Computing)是一种通过硬件和软件的结合来增强计算机系统安全性的方法。该概念最早由可信计算组(Trusted Computing Group,TCG)提出,其目标是使计算机系统能够更加可靠地执行应用程序,并保护数据免受各种安全威胁。
可信计算主要依赖于一个可信平台模块(TPM),这是一个嵌入在计算机硬件中的安全加密芯片。TPM可以负责存储安全密钥、数字证书等敏感信息,并能够在计算机启动过程中进行验证,确保软件的完整性。在可信计算的架构中,所有敏感数据的处理都必须在可信环境中进行,这样才能有效防止恶意软件的攻击。
区块链是一种分布式数据库技术,其核心在于数据以链条的形式存储在多个节点上,每个节点都有一个完整的数据副本。这一特性使得区块链具有高度的安全性和透明性。一旦数据被记录在区块链上,即使是网络中的管理者也无法随意篡改。
区块链的基本架构包括以下几个部分:节点、区块、链和共识机制。区块由多个交易数据构成,并带有时间戳和哈希值,以确保数据的不可篡改性。共识机制是区块链网络中节点之间达成一致的方法,不同类型的共识机制(如POW、POS等)各有其特点和优缺点。
可信计算和区块链的结合可以提高区块链系统的安全性和可信度。在传统的区块链中,由于节点之间的数据是公开透明的,因此在某些情况下,恶意节点可能会利用信息不对称的情况进行攻击。而通过引入可信计算技术,能够确保数据在一个受信任的环境中处理,进而增强安全性。
可信计算区块链通过以下几个方面提升了区块链技术的安全性:
1. **数据加密与存储**:通过可信计算的硬件加密技术,确保区块链上存储的数据在传输和存储过程中的安全性。
2. **执行环境的可信性**:通过可信计算,保证交易和合约在可信环境中执行,防止代码篡改和数据泄露。
3. **隐私保护**:结合可信计算的隐私计算能力,可以在保证数据隐私的前提下进行智能合约的验证和执行。
可信计算区块链的优势使其在多个领域中展现出广泛的应用可能性,包括:
尽管可信计算区块链展现出良好的前景,但在实际应用中仍面临了一些挑战。
首先,技术的复杂性使其在实现上存在障碍。可信计算和区块链各自都有其独特的技术特性,如何将两者有效结合并运用是一个需要解决的技术难题。
其次,监管政策的缺失也是制约其发展的因素之一。目前在许多国家和地区,关于区块链和可信计算的法律和政策尚不成熟,这使得相关领域的创新和应用受到限制。
未来,随着技术的不断成熟以及政策的完善,可信计算区块链有望在数据安全、隐私保护等方面发挥越来越重要的作用,也将在数字经济中占据一席之地。
可信计算区块链通过将可信计算的安全环境与区块链的数据管理相结合来增强数据的安全性。可信计算确保了数据在一个受信任的环境中进行处理和存储,而区块链则提供数据的不变性和透明性,这样即使在面临恶意攻击时,数据的安全性和完整性也能得到保障。
在实际应用中,可信计算区块链可以对传输中的数据进行加密,并通过智能合约确保数据在合法的、可信的条件下共享。例如,在医疗健康领域,患者的病历信息可以在不直接暴露个人身份信息的情况下,在不同医疗机构之间安全地交换和访问。此举不仅维护患者的隐私,同时也增强了数据共享的安全性。
隐私保护是现代数字经济中一个至关重要的问题,而可信计算区块链在这方面具备独特的优势。首先,可信计算可以提供隔离的、硬件级别的执行环境,确保只有通过验证的代码能够操作敏感数据。在区块链的上下文中,这意味着智能合约可以在不泄露用户身份或其他敏感信息的情况下执行。
此外,可信计算区块链支持零知识证明等先进密码学机制,允许一方验证另一方所持信息的真实性,而无需披露相关数据本身。例如,在区块链上执行某些交易时,交易者可以通过零知识证明提交证明而不透露其具体的资产信息,从而有效地保护隐私。
传统数据加密是一种将数据转换为不可读格式以保护其安全性的技术,通常以密钥进行加解密。然而,可信计算引入的概念不仅仅是保护数据不被外部攻击,还确保数据在处理过程中不会被篡改。同时,可信计算技术(例如TPM)还可以提供硬件级别的安全保障,确保敏感密钥的存储和处理是在受保护的环境中进行。
与传统加密相比,可信计算允许更复杂的处理和计算,即使在数据被加密的情况下,也可以在受信环境中进行安全地处理。这为许多需要高级隐私和数据保护的应用场合(如医疗、金融等)提供了新的可能性。
选择可信计算区块链的技术方案时,首先需要明确自己的需求和应用场景。不同的行业在数据安全、隐私保护和合规性方面都有不同的要求,因此需要选择能够满足这些需求的技术方案。
其次,还需要考虑技术的可扩展性和兼容性。选择一个可以与现有系统集成的技术方案至关重要,这样可以避免在技术迁移过程中带来的复杂性和成本。此外,技术方案的社区支持和开发活跃程度也是一个需要考量的因素,成熟的开源项目通常拥有更加丰富的支持文档和活跃的开发者社区。
未来可信计算区块链的发展趋势将会受到若干因素的影响,其中技术的不断进步、市场需求的变化以及政策法规的完善都将发挥重要作用。首先,随着计算能力的提升,可信计算和区块链技术将会更加高效且具备更强的处理能力,这为其在更多复杂场景下的应用奠定基础。
其次,市场对于数据隐私的重视程度在不断提高,政府和企业将越来越倾向于采用可信计算区块链来保护用户数据。此外,随着公众意识的提升和对信息安全的关注,企业在进行数据处理时将更倾向于选择能够提供高安全性和隐私保护的解决方案。
最后,政策和法律法规的完善将进一步推动可信计算区块链的发展,企业不仅需要遵循现有的数据保护法律,还需要考虑到未来可能的法规变化,选择灵活且具有适应性的技术方案,以应对市场环境的变化。
综上所述,可信计算区块链作为连接可信计算与区块链的桥梁,既提升了区块链系统的安全性,又为数据隐私和安全保护提供了有力支撑。展望未来,随着技术的不断演进和应用场景的拓展,可信计算区块链必将在各个领域中产生深远的影响。
2003-2025 TP官网下载TP @版权所有|网站地图|渝ICP备2023015121号